325-5028. The Defense Nuclear Agency (DNA) is seeking qualified
contractors with experience and capabilities related to the future of
the Automated Routing and Maintenance System (ARMS) Version 4.0
Software Development and the Maintenance of ARMS. The new effort is
called the Air Vehicle Planning System (APS) Version 2. APS is a force
level mission planning tool, used to build mission packages of one to
many air vehicles. APS 2 will expand the capabilities of the APS, to
include reconnaissance and low observable air vehicle modeling,
integration of TERCOM Placement and Evaluation Program (TPEP), enhance
reporting, distributed collaborative planning, mission analysis,
Nuclear Planning and Execution System (NPES) support, Global Command
and Control System (GCCS) compliance, United States Strategic Command
(USSTRATCOM) enterprise database compliance, and re-engineering of the
current system. Use of off-the-shelf technology will be highly
